Andrew Garfield is a British-American actor who has starred in various feature films since the early 2000s. The actor of Peter Parker in 2 The Amazing Spider-Man films has received Oscar, Golden Globe, and BAFTA nominations from other films he has starred in. Pop culture fans may also know him for his famous ex-girlfriend, Emma Stone, who plays Spider-Man's lover Gwen Stacy.
It is impossible to group Andrew Garfield into just one type of role. He has played superheroes, World War II heroes, AIDS patients, and other roles that require good acting skills. 1. His Accent Shocks Emma Stone and His Fans
Fans accustomed to hearing Andrew Garfield speak with an American accent were taken aback when he spoke in his native British accent at the Oscars or Academy Awards in 2017. His ex-girlfriend, Emma Stone, explained that Andrew spoke with a fluent American accent during the filming. When filming was over, she realized that the real Andrew didn't really speak with that American accent.
Although Garfield was born in Los Angeles, United States, his mother is from Essex, England. Both of his grandparents are also from England. When Andrew was three years old, his family moved back to England and lived there until he was an adult.
Andrew's family comes from Jewish ethnicity, his family also has mixed blood from Polish, Russian, and Romanian.
2. Also Became a Businessman
Andrew Garfield originally planned to study business. His sister is a doctor, and his parents run an interior design business. His father was also the head coach of the Guildford City swimming club. In his childhood, Andrew was a gymnast and swimmer. Andrew became interested in acting at the age of sixteen, and he eventually trained at the Central School of Speech and Drama at the University of London.
3. He has Won Tony Awards
Andrew Garfield has starred in dozens of films so far and one of them won him the Tony Awards. He has been nominated for an Oscar, two Golden Globes, and two BAFTAs
In addition to his appearance in Hacksaw Ridge, The Amazing Spider-Man, The Social Network, and Never Let Me Go, Andrew's film credits span a dozen years. In 2005 he starred in two films at once namely Sugar Rush and Swinging.
When Garfield won a Tony Award for best lead actor in Angels in America, he dedicated his award to the LGBTQ community. In the film, he played an AIDS patient at the height of the AIDS crisis in the United States.
4. He is a Fan of RuPaul’s Drag Race
As part of Andrew Garfield's research for his role in Angels in America, he started watching RuPaul's Drag Race. Since Andrew's character will also be dressed in Drag style, he wants to understand more about the art of Drag. In an interview following the release of the film, he said Drag Race might be the best thing he's ever seen on TV.
Andrew met the two RuPaul's Drag Race contestants, Kim Chi and Detox, and said he was “in love” with Detox.
5. He is Secretive About His Personal Life
Andrew Garfield is happy to give interviews about his work, but keeps his personal life secret to himself. He's so good at keeping secrets private that when his relationship with Emma Stone ended, the couple never discussed the speculation or released a public statement about it.
When asked about his sexual orientation in an interview, he said he identified as heterosexual, but he was open to an impulse that might arise within him as well.

6. He Also Love Acting on Stage
Andrew Garfield enjoys the challenge of continuing to put on a good show on stage, a method as opposed to filmmaking. Andrew enjoys his experience on stage, and claims the theater as his second home. He also enjoys being able to be so close to his audience, which is a very different feeling to being a character away from the audience like on a movie screen.
7. He is Touched When Wearing the Spider-Man Costume
The next interesting fact about Andrew Garfield is that he became very moved the first time he put on the Spider-Man costume. Growing up in the era of Marvel comics, he has adored the superhero since he was a child. Being able to play one of his idols on the big screen must have had a big impact on the veteran actor.
Andrew played the character in 2012's The Amazing Spider-Man, and its 2014 sequel, before the role was finally assigned to Tom Holland.
8. He is Happy Tom Holland Replaced Him
The Amazing Spider-Man 3 project, which should have been played again by Andrew Garfield, was canceled for some reason. The character Spider-Man reappeared in Captain America Civil War but was not played by Andrew. When Tom Holland replaced Andrew in the role of Spider-Man, Andrew had nothing but positive words for the younger actor. He was happy to pass the baton and praised Tom Holland's acting skills.
9. Got an Oscar Nomination with Hacksaw Ridge
When Andrew Garfield was nominated for an Academy Award for his role as Desmond Doss in Hacksaw Ridge, he was one of only four young actors born after 1980 to be nominated for an Oscar.
His role as the historical figure of the original World War II hero added him to a list of Oscar-nominated young actors that includes only Ryan Gosling, Eddie Redmayne and Jesse Eisenberg. His slick performance also earned him a Golden Globe and BAFTA nomination.
10. Fans Demanded Him to Play Spider-Man Again
After the Multiverse adventure in Spider-Man No Way Home, there is a lot of news indicating that Sony Pictures is in talks to bring back Andrew Garfield as Spider-Man for some of his future film projects.
Andrew became much talked about and trended on Twitter, with many fans starting a Justice League-inspired Snyder Cut campaign to bring back The Amazing Spider-Man 3, Andrew's canceled Spider-Man film.

Now, Sony reportedly wants Andrew Garfield back for some new Spider-Man film projects. Since the record-breaking Spider-Man: No Way Home, nearly every Marvel fan has taken to social media to express their love for Andrew Garfield's portrayal and demand that he star in another Marvel film.
In Spider-Man No Way Home, Garfield's Peter Parker character states that he "wants to fight aliens". Fans immediately took the remark about the alien as a clue to Andrew's next appearance, linking the Morbius film to Andrew's possible appearance as Spider-Man.
With rumors suggesting that the Morbius film is set in the "Venom-Verse" where Tom Hardy's version of Eddie Brock lives and the existence of OSCORP tower from The Amazing Spider-Man film series, it's clear that this Morbius exist in Andrew Garfield's Spider-Man universe.
Andrew Garfield is one of the highest trending topics on Twitter, as many have accredited the actor for getting the spotlight on films based on Marvel comics.
